I was hoping to get a nice sized above ground pool this summer. Especially since I have no idea of there will end up being day camp, I need a way to keep my kids entertained.

I figured I'd spend about $500-600 and get a pool that's at least 4 feet deep and 12 feet wide. At least that's what it used to cost.....

For some reason, this summer, they're completely unavailable. I've looked all over the place and at all the major brands, and the doesn't seem to be any in the entire US or Canada for sale.

So now I need to put something in my backyard to entertain kids from teens down to little ones. We recently moved, and we now have plenty of space in the backyard. I thought of a water slide, but they're really expensive.

Ideas????????

Trampoline, inflatable water slide (we got one on Amazon for under $200), basketball hoop, soccer goals, croquet, swingset, zipline, batting cage, gokarts, cornhole, sandbox - any of those speak to you?

If you buy a filter and a tarp you can make your own frame out of pallets - ma not last you more then the summer, but it would be cheaper then other options.

If you aren't handy find out if someone has handy teens who would do it for minimal payment...
